Ulunda
Kuchinda block · Sambalpur district, Odisha · PIN 768222 · village code 381436
Population 2011
1,072
Census of India
Population 2020
1,174
Mission Antyodaya survey
Change
+9.5%
102 people · 1.0% a year
Households
287
-2.7% vs 295 in 2011
Census 2011
Total population
1,072
Male / female
550 / 522
Sex ratio females per 1,000 males
949
Children aged 0–6
112
Literacy rate
58.1%
Scheduled Caste / Scheduled Tribe
96 / 601
Working population
633
Of workers, in agriculture cultivators and farm labour
84.8%
Households
295
